Energy storage requirements for Tonga s new energy projects
The project will deliver utility-scale storage systems to provide base load response and grid stability, paving the way for more renewable energy integration in the main island, while green mini-grids will be installed in the outer islands. The island nation currently relies on diesel generators for 90% of its power – a costly and environmentally unsustainable solution. "Pacific Island. . The two battery storage facilities installed in Tonga are complementary: the aim of the first 5 MWh / 10 MW battery is to improve the electricity grid's stability (regulating the voltage and frequency), while the second 23 MWh / 7 MW battery is designed to transfer the electrical load in order to. . The Government of Tonga has formulated targets to transform its energy sector by achieving a 50 percent share of renewables in the country's energy generation mix by 2020 and 70 percent by 2030. Private companies have announced $4 billion in investment into the manufacturing of clean energy gener-ation technology in Georgia, the third highest in the country behind only Texas and California. 1 This invest-ment is expected to create 7,151 jobs and, of the total, 88 percent has been announced. . Earlier this month, Georgia Power Company submitted its 2023 Integrated Resource Plan Update (2023 IRP Update) to the Georgia Public Service Commission, which includes an Application for Certification for four battery energy storage systems totaling 500 MW. New energy storage battery box material
Various materials are typically utilized for constructing energy storage battery boxes. These include polymer composites, aluminum alloys, steel, and environmentally friendly materials such as bioplastics and recycled substances.
